Crossroads There are moments where we find ourselves at a crossroad, without a road map. The choices we make in those moments can define the rest of our days. It seems that the whole world is at a crossroads right now. Everyone and everything have changed and the way we will proceed in life and business will change as well. Many of our friends and colleagues are contempla ng re rement or pursuing other less stressful avenues and adventures. Long me employees are moving on to environments where they think they may not need to work as hard. Many employees are simply not engaged and making bad decisions. We seem to be overworking the good ones and contribu ng to the “viscous circle”. Where does it end? Many of us are at a crossroads as well. We are trying to navigate through unknown waters and uncharted territory making up a new set of guidelines as we go. The way that we once conducted our business has changed. The way we manage our people and a empt to hire new people has changed. We will need to find new ways to make this business seem appealing to the new workforce. We all know what a challenge it has been to find and keep good people in our stores. That challenge has worsened over the past several months. People of all ages seem to have a different outlook on working in general. Many s ll don’t “need” to work due to assistance and the ones that are considering employment are seeking wages that do not calculate into our budgets. Unfortunately, this will drive higher prices and in the end we will ALL be affected. Even the innocent bystanders. We, as managers are being held to much higher standards than ever while people, supply, support and morality seem to have taken a back seat. STAY POSITIVE! Your President,
